My Donegal… with LYIT Student Union President Dylan Mc Gowan

written by Elaine McCallig July 26, 2016
Facebook0Tweet0LinkedIn0Print0

Dylan Mc Gowan is 24 years old and originally from County Leitrim. Dylan has a strong interest in sports and has a Level 8 degree in Sports Coaching and Performance.

He sits on many different committees and delegations such as the US Embassy Youth council and the SITT Rural Transport board as well as many other committees that requires student opinion in LYIT.

Last year Dylan ran a jobs initiative call “BESS” which helps students and businesses connect with regards to part-time employment. His main ambitions this year is to drive the productivity of the Union to another level and make every student know that if they need help the Student’s Union team are there for them.

As spokesperson of LYITSU, he outlines that they will be taking a strong stance this year against the recommendation of a loan scheme as illustrated in the Cassells report.

 

 

This is Dylan’s Donegal…

 

(1) What is your favourite place in Donegal and why?
Quigley’s Point – Inishowen, friendships and McGowan’s bar of course.

 

(2) If you could change one thing about Donegal what would it be?
I would put a railway station in place to make it more accessible

 

(3) Who is the one person in Donegal that you look up to and why?
Jim McGuinness, I have a fond interest in his line of work as a Sports Psychologist.

 

(4) Daniel O’Donnell or Packie Bonner?
Packie Bonner

 

(5) What has been Donegal’s proudest moment in recent years?
Has to be winning the All-Ireland.

 

(6) What was Donegal’s saddest moment?
Losing to Tyrone this year?

 

(7) What is your favourite Donegal-made product?
Donegal Creamery milk

 

(8) Who is Donegal’s greatest ambassador around the world and why?
Seamus Coleman at this current moment in time.

 

(9) Who is Donegal’s most successful businessperson in your opinion?
McGettigan’s

 

(10) Who is your favourite Donegal sportsperson of all time?
Shay Given

 

(11) What is your favourite Donegal restaurant?
Restaurant Sage in Letterkenny

 

(12) Donegal’s golden eagles or basking sharks?
Basking Sharks

 

(13) What is your favourite Donegal saying or expression?
“Yes boy”

 

(14) What is the biggest challenge facing the people of Donegal today?
Accessibility to different places in Ireland.

 

(15) What is your favourite Donegal food?
Donegal Catch

 

(16) Is there anything that really annoys you about Donegal or its people?
The hills.

 

(17) Do you have a favourite local band?
Phat Kidz

 

(18) What’s the most rewarding part of being LYIT SU president?
Being able to help students with their problems and achieve positive results.

 

(19) What’s your favourite thing about LYIT ?
The community of LYIT as a whole is my favourite thing about LYIT.

 

(20) Is there anything about Donegal that you are very proud of?
The success of the All-Ireland and transforming GAA to another level in the county.
